Introduction

In accordance with Tariff Part VII, Subpart B, section 304, PJM performed load flow analysis (Transition Sort Retool) on all AE1 through AG1 projects that have met eligibility requirements according to Tariff, Part VII, Subpart B, section 303. The purpose of this study is to determine whether a project would be classified as eligible for the Expedited Process (Fast Lane) or if it would be reprioritized to be studied as part of Transition Cycle #1 (TC1) using the criteria from the Expedited Process Eligibility section of Tariff Part VII, section 304. This is not a System Impact Study report.

Below are the results of the study, details of how the study was performed, criterion used in the evaluation of the Expedited Process vs. TC1 determination, and next steps in the interconnection process for your project.

Transition Cycle #1:

The AG1-083 project has not met the Expedited Process Eligibility requirements in Tariff Part VII, Subpart B, section 304 and will therefore be reprioritized to Transition Cycle #1. Please see "Transition Cycle #1 Rules" below.

Transition Sort Retool Study Process and Criteria:

In order to determine Expedited Process vs. Transition Cycle #1 classification, projects which met the Transition Eligibility requirements from Tariff Part VII, Subpart B, section 303 were studied on the base case model that was used for the original System Impact Study analysis. Both a summer peak and light load load flow analysis were performed. Projects that have cost allocation eligibility or are identified as the first to cause a system violation which requires the need for a Network Upgrade with a total estimated cost greater than $5 million will be reprioritized to Transition Cycle #1. All other projects will be eligible for the expedited procedures set forth in Tariff Part VII, Subpart B, section 304 (B).

Expedited Process Eligibility: OATT Tariff Part VII, section 304:

A project is not eligible for the expedited process if it has cost allocation eligibility or is identified as the first to cause, as determined according to Tariff, Part VI, section 217.3, for a Network Upgrade which has a total estimated cost of greater than $5,000,000. Such cost estimate will be based on Transmission Provider's most recently available data.

Not considered in the Transition Sorting: The cost of the Interconnection Facilities is not considered when determining a project's eligibility for the expedited process. Affected Systems upgrade costs are also not considered in the evaluation.

Next Steps for your project:

Transition Cycle #1 Rules:

Refer to Tariff Part VII, Subpart B, section 304 (C) for the Transition Cycle #1 Project Rules.

Transition Cycle #1 will start no later than one year from the Transition Start Date (July 10, 2023). Transition Cycle #1 will run simultaneously with the expedited process, however Transition Cycle #1, Phase III will not begin until all expedited process projects have been completed.

Projects that are reprioritized to Transition Cycle #1 will not need to re-apply to the Interconnection Cycle Process. Therefore, there is no Application Review Phase for Transition Cycle #1. The cycle process for Transition Cycle #1 includes three Study Phases and three Decision Points:

  1. Phase I System Impact Study and Decision Point I; and
  2. Phase II System Impact Study and Decision Point II; and
  3. Phase III System Impact Study and Decision Point III

Refer to Tariff Part VII, Subpart D, section 307 for the Transition Cycle #1 study process.

General

The Interconnection Customer (IC), has proposed a Solar; Storage generating facility located in the Dominion zone — Hertford County, North Carolina. The installed facilities will have a total capability of 20.0 MW with 12.0 MW of this output being recognized by PJM as Capacity.

Project Information
Queue Number AG1-083
Project Name Ahoskie 34.5 kV
Developer Name NC-4 Ahoskie North, LLC
State North Carolina
County Hertford
Transmission Owner Dominion
MFO 20.0 MW
MWE 20.0 MW
MWC 12.0 MW
Fuel Type Solar; Storage
Basecase Study Year 2024

Point of Interconnection

AG1-083 will interconnect with the Dominion transmission system at the Ahoskie 115 kV substation.

System Reinforcements
RTEP ID Title Total Cost
n7540 Reconductor 115 kV Line #136 from Earleys to Ahoskie. $4,676,000
n8237 Reconductor 2.15 miles of 115 kV Line 108 from Boykins to AG1-343 with 768.2 ACSS 250 C. Replace Wave Trap and Breaker Switch at Boykins terminal. $1,640,000
n7541 230/115 kV Transformer Addition $6,000,000
n8235 Reconductor 10.36 miles of 115 kV Line 108 from Murphys to AG1-343 with 768.2 ACSS 250 C. $6,216,000
n6618.1 Hathaway 115 kV Bus Split. $20,749
n6118 Upgrade the breaker leads at DVPs Battleboro terminal will bring the rating to 239/239/239 MVA (Limited by terminal equipment at Rocky Mount) $100,000
s2825.2 Rebuild line #55 Tarboro to Hart Mills. $3,500,000
(TBD) Reconductor 8.5 miles RockyMt-Battleborro with single 795 ACSS-TW per phase, upgrade disconnect switches and CT ratios. $31,000,000
s2825.1 Rebuild entire line#2167 Edgecombe NUG to Hathaway. $39,500,000
n7740 Reconductor 115 kV Line #93 from South Hampton to Watkins. $656,000
s2609.8 Rebuild approximately 10 miles segment of 230kV Line #205 from Locks to Tyler and upgrade the terminal equipment. The minimum summer normal rating of the line segment will be 1572MVA. $27,000,000
s2824 Rebuild 230 kV Line #2056 from Hornertown to Hathaway. $49,100,000
